Enjoy delicious homemade cookies even without chocolate chips. These cookies are soft on the inside, slightly crispy on the edges, and perfect with a glass of milk.
Ingredients: 1 cup butter, softened. 1 cup granulated sugar. 1 egg. 2 cups all-purpose flour. 1/2 teaspoon baking soda. 1/4 teaspoon salt. 1 teaspoon vanilla extract.
Instructions: Set the oven to 350F 175C and heat it up. Melt the butter and mix it with the sugar in a large bowl until the mixture is smooth. Add the egg and vanilla extract and mix them in well. Mix the flour, baking soda, and salt together in a different bowl. Slowly add the dry ingredients to the wet ones and mix them together until they are just combined. Place dough balls on a baking sheet, leaving space between them so they can spread. Press down a little on each cookie with your fingers or the back of a spoon. After the oven is hot, bake for 10 to 12 minutes, or until the edges are just beginning to turn golden. After taking the cookies out of the oven, let them cool for a few minutes on the baking sheet before moving them to a wire rack to cool all the way down.
Prep Time: 15 minutes
Cook Time: 10 minutes
